What Creates Backflow?


There are numerous reasons a heartburn can occur in your home, however the two significant wrongdoers are backpressure as well as back-siphonage.
Backpressure happens when the pressure in pipes presses liquids and also gas in the contrary direction where the stress is reduced. This event can take place due to a rise in central heating boiler temperature level, absence of adequate vents in water heating systems, and so on.
Back siphonage, on the other hand, is the opposite of backpressure. In this case, gas or water is pushed back right into the plumbing system as pressure decrease in the pipelines. When this takes place, dangerous liquids or water can be made right into the water system, polluting it at the same time.

What is Backflow Testing and Why do You Need One?

 

Backflow Prevention 101

 

Before going to the benefits of backflow testing, it’s important to understand how backflow prevention works.


Water distribution systems are designed to maintain a significant pressure to allow water to flow from the faucet, shower, and other water fixtures. A good functioning backflow preventer protects clean water supplies from polluted or contaminated water due to backflow.


However, when water pressure occurs due to burst or frozen pipes, polluted water from other sources travels backward – soon entering the potable water distribution system. That’s when air gap and backflow prevention devices come into play.

 

Atmospheric Vacuum Breaker

 

n AVB prevents the backflow of contaminated liquids into the main potable water system. It’s usually installed at least six inches above the peak usage point, such as sprinklers.

Protects Community Health

 

When all backflow prevention devices in the community undergo annual inspection and testing, then there’s a lower chance of having contaminated water.


Without regular backflow testing, the members from the surrounding area may suffer from water-borne diseases. Examples include amoebiasis and bacterial gastroenteritis due to drinking polluted water.


For this reason, the government enforces strict backflow testing compliance to cities and municipalities with corresponding imposed penalties for violators. The authorities require districts to install backflow preventers and have a backflow prevention plan.
